Output 73fa4ec6bf9315f05b29ebf376c85aa45ffbc15176ca634dd503cfb073f80c0e:10

value
17918559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ed2b37c9656f48c6a929f85272205a84c048cbc OP_EQUAL
address
3GAo6d7Rf1am9pH3GS1eRXzn65Ne3i1PGa
transaction
73fa4ec6bf9315f05b29ebf376c85aa45ffbc15176ca634dd503cfb073f80c0e
spent
true